What is the difference between Non Union Lock Desk vs Mortgage Loan Processor?

AspectNon Union Lock DeskMortgage Loan Processor
CredentialsTypically requires mortgage licensing, familiarity with lock policiesRequires mortgage licensing, loan documentation knowledge
Work EnvironmentBank or mortgage company, fast-paced, detail-orientedBank or lending institution, processing loan files, customer communication
Industry UsageUsed in mortgage lending to manage rate locksUsed across mortgage lending to prepare and verify loan documents

The Non Union Lock Desk primarily focuses on managing mortgage rate locks and ensuring compliance with lock policies, while the Mortgage Loan Processor handles the preparation, verification, and processing of loan documentation. Both roles require mortgage licensing and work within the mortgage industry, but they serve different functions in the loan lifecycle.

About the Role
The Lock Desk Manager leads our lock desk while staying hands-on in the work. You're still reviewing and verifying lock requests, registering loans with investors, and issuing confirmations, and on top of that you own the health of the desk: monitoring margins and revenue, running the reports that show how we're performing, and serving as our Optimal Blue administrator. You set the standard for accuracy and responsiveness, you're the final word on lock policy, and you make sure pricing and profitability stay protected on every file. It's a player-coach role built for someone who wants to lead without losing touch with the desk.
A Day in the Life
Morning
You start with the market. Rate sheets come in, pricing moves, and lock requests are waiting. You're locking loans alongside the team, reviewing and verifying requests, confirming pricing in Optimal Blue, and registering loans with investors. When sales or operations has a lock policy question, it comes to you, and you keep the desk moving at pace.
Afternoon
You shift into the parts of the job only you own. You monitor margins and revenue, watching for anything that puts profitability at risk. You run and review reports on desk performance, and you manage Optimal Blue as its administrator, keeping pricing rules, configurations, and investor setups current. You handle extensions and loan restructures that affect pricing, keep the secondary tab and lock confirmations current in LendingPad, and stay in close contact with your investor reps as pricing and guidelines shift. Throughout, you're supporting your team and making sure the desk runs clean.
Major Goals and Responsibilities
Locking and Confirmations
  • Review, verify, and lock incoming LO lock requests
  • Register loans with investors and issue confirmations to the appropriate parties
  • Enter lock request and confirmation information accurately and efficiently into the LOS
  • Extend locks and assist in loan restructures
  • Audit locks for accuracy

Margins, Revenue, and Reporting
  • Monitor margins and revenue to protect profitability across the pipeline
  • Run and review reports on lock desk performance
  • Flag and address risks to pricing and margin before they become problems

Systems and Administration
  • Serve as the Optimal Blue administrator, managing pricing rules, configurations, and investor setups
  • Keep the secondary tab and lock confirmations in LendingPad updated throughout the life of the loan

Leadership and Communication
  • Set the standard for accuracy and responsiveness on the desk
  • Serve as the final resource for lock policy questions from sales and operations
  • Build and maintain investor relationships, communicating lock changes and building rapport
